...FLOOD WATCH REMAINS IN EFFECT FROM SATURDAY MORNING THROUGH
SUNDAY EVENING...

* WHAT...Flooding caused by excessive rainfall continues to be
  possible.

* WHERE...Portions of east central Ohio, including the following
  areas, Belmont, Guernsey, Monroe, Muskingum and Noble,
  Pennsylvania, including the following areas, Allegheny, Fayette,
  Greene, Washington and Westmoreland, and West Virginia, including
  the following areas, Brooke, Preston, Tucker, Marion, Marshall,
  Monongalia, Ohio, and Wetzel.

* WHEN...From Saturday morning through Sunday evening.

* IMPACTS...Excessive runoff may result in flooding of rivers,
  creeks, streams, and other low-lying and flood-prone locations.
  Creeks and streams may rise out of their banks. Flooding may occur
  in poor drainage and urban areas.

* ADDITIONAL DETAILS...
  - One and one half to two inches of rain is possible Saturday
    into Sunday.
  - http://www.weather.gov/safety/flood

P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S...

You should monitor later forecasts and be alert for possible Flood
Warnings. Those living in areas prone to flooding should be prepared
to take action should flooding develop.
